Seitai (整体) is a Japanese practice that helps you reconnect with your body’s innate intelligence. Through subtle awareness and guided techniques, you’ll be invited to: Listen deeply to your body through Yuki (a meditative, hands-on practice of sensing and following the breath). Release hidden tension with Katsugen — allowing involuntary, spontaneous movements to arise naturally. Find balance in stillness and movement, letting your body recalibrate itself in surprising ways. Seitai is not about control or forcing; it’s about giving voice to the movements your body has been waiting to express. Sometimes this brings ease, clarity, and lightness. We challenge you to join us in the next two weeks for a daily silent walk in the morning through Hasenheide. **In a nutshell:** we meet at 07:55 am in front of Little Johns Bikes (1 minute walk away from metro Südstern), and at 08:00 am we start walking together into Hasenheide for a one-hour loop, finishing where we started. It is a completely silent activity, from start to finish, from hello to goodbye, and we ask you to respect that. Even if you come with friends, please do not talk during the walk. **Why should you join these walks?** The idea is to create space for a few simple things. First, a chance to start the day by being outside and seeing morning light for a longer stretch of time. Morning light helps regulate our circadian rhythm, and being outdoors makes that light much more effective than staying inside. Second, a chance to be together without small talk, or any talk at all. We invite you to feel accompanied without having to think about what to say or make conversation. Third, a chance to take some mindful time. While we walk, we invite you to notice the park around you and stay in the moment. What was your favourite bird today? How many bikes passed us? What sound do our steps make on grass, and how does that change on gravel? We will offer one optional daily question or challenge to help you stay grounded. The hosts, meditators and Kriya Yoga initiates for over 50 years, are direct disciples of Yogacharya J. Oliver Black one of Paramahansa Yogananda's most advanced male disciples. He is the founder of Golden Lotus, Inc., which owns & operates 'Song of the Morning' an 800 acre Yoga Retreat Northest of Gaylord, MI on the Pigeon River. Paramahansa Yogananda founded Self Realization Fellowship, headquartered in Los Angeles, CA and is the author of the Spritual Classic, 'Autobiography of a Yogi.'
